Scaling New Heights: The Majestic Vidova Gora

Experience breathtaking views and nature's beauty at Vidova Gora, the highest peak on Brač Island, a must-visit destination for adventure seekers.

Nestled in the heart of Brač Island, Vidova Gora stands proudly as the highest peak, soaring to an impressive 778 meters above sea level. This majestic mountain is not only a haven for hikers and nature lovers but also a treasure trove of breathtaking vistas. As you ascend the well-marked trails, you'll be captivated by the diverse flora and fauna that thrive in this protected area. The path is relatively accessible, making it suitable for both seasoned hikers and casual walkers ready to embrace the great outdoors. Upon reaching the summit, visitors are rewarded with panoramic views that stretch across the sparkling Adriatic Sea to the nearby islands, including Hvar and Vis. On clear days, the sight is nothing short of spectacular, offering an unforgettable backdrop for photographs and moments of reflection. The tranquility of the environment, coupled with the expansive views, creates a perfect esc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. As you explore Vidova Gora, keep an eye out for the local wildlife, which includes various bird species and unique plants indigenous to this region. The area is a part of a larger natural park, emphasizing the importance of conservation and respect for the environment. Whether you're looking for a challenging hike, a serene picnic spot, or simply a place to soak in the natural beauty of Croatia, Vidova Gora promises an enriching experience that will remain etched in your memory long after your visit.

Local tips

  • Visit early in the morning or late in the afternoon for cooler temperatures and stunning sunrise or sunset views.
  • Wear sturdy hiking shoes and bring plenty of water, as the trails can be steep and challenging.
  • Take your time to enjoy the diverse flora and fauna along the trail; bring a camera to capture the stunning scenery.
  • Check local weather conditions before your hike to ensure a safe and enjoyable experience.
  • Consider visiting during the shoulder seasons (spring or fall) for fewer crowds and pleasant weather.
